Integrity Innovation Accountability Commitment to Excellence Teamwork Values Item 5O Approve the proposed sidewalk projects for construction using FY Capital Improvement Plan funds

Integrity Innovation Accountability Commitment to Excellence Teamwork Values Sidewalk Project Recommendations The City’s FY budget allocates the following for sidewalk/trail projects throughout the city:The City’s FY budget allocates the following for sidewalk/trail projects throughout the city: –$200,000 in the Strategic Initiative Fund; and –$110,000 in the SPDC Fund The SPDC funds are required to be utilized north of F.M and require Park Board and SPDC approval before construction can commence.The SPDC funds are required to be utilized north of F.M and require Park Board and SPDC approval before construction can commence.

Integrity Innovation Accountability Commitment to Excellence Teamwork Values Sidewalk Project Recommendations Based on the 2005 Pathways Plan, Southlake 2025 Plan, existing sidewalks/trails, and destinations such as schools and shopping, City Staff is recommending the following projects to be funded using Strategic Initiative Fund dollars:Based on the 2005 Pathways Plan, Southlake 2025 Plan, existing sidewalks/trails, and destinations such as schools and shopping, City Staff is recommending the following projects to be funded using Strategic Initiative Fund dollars: 1.North Carroll Avenue from Estes Park to Carroll Meadows; 2.North Carroll Avenue from Taylor Street to Carroll Middle School; 3.Silicon Drive from Nolen Drive to Dragon Stadium; 4.W. Continental Boulevard from Deer Hollow Boulevard to Peytonville Avenue along the north side of Continental Blvd.; 5.Continental Boulevard from Old Union Elementary School to Carroll Avenue along Noble Oaks Park 6.Byron Nelson from Parkwood Drive to F.M along the city property; 7.F.M at Foxborough; and 8.S. Carroll Avenue from Westmont Dr. to the future Shops of Southlake.
